Bàsquet Girona will face Guipúzcoa Basket for the first time this Sunday (6:00 p.m.) at the Illunbe in Sant Sebastià. The Basque team, founded in 2001, has twelve seasons in its history competing in the highest category of state basketball. Guipúscoa is one of the six teams with a record of four wins and four losses. 

Lorenzo Encinas, a native of San Sebastian, has taken over the reins of the Basque team after being the assistant coach of Bilbao Basket for the past two seasons. Xabi Oroz and Mikel Motos are the only two pieces that have had continuity in the team after ACB’s relegation. From Guipúzcoa, the external scoring of Benjamin Simons and the internal intimidation of Domagoj Proleta stand out.
